Meet Your New Space-Saving Sidekick

At first glance, you might do a double-take. "Paper?" you ask. "For a table that holds my morning coffee, bedtime book, and charging phone?" Absolutely. This isn't your average craft project. The paper narrow side table is built from high-strength paper tubes—think of them as the unsung heroes of sustainable design—paired with clever 3-way and 4-way connectors that lock everything into place without a single screw. The result? A sleek, minimalist piece that's narrow enough for tight hallways or beside a slim sofa, but roomy enough to keep your essentials organized: a drawer for your, an open shelf for your favorite potted plant or stack of magazines.

And let's talk about that "narrow" part. Measuring in at just 35cm deep (you can customize the width, by the way), it slides effortlessly into spots where traditional furniture would never fit: between your bed and the wall in a studio apartment, beside your entryway bench for keys and mail, or even as a mini bar cart in your kitchen nook. Why Paper? Let's Count the Ways

You've heard the buzzwords: eco-friendly, sustainable, lightweight. But let's get real—what makes this paper narrow side table actually better than the wooden or plastic ones cluttering store shelves? Let's break it down, no jargon allowed.

Feature Why It Matters for You
Tool-Free Assembly (Yes, Really) No more hunting for that missing Allen wrench or crying over confusing instruction manuals. The modular design clicks together like a well-designed puzzle—we timed it, and most people have it fully built in under 10 minutes. Just connect the paper tubes with the color-coded 3-way/4-way connectors, pop on the plastic foot covers, and done. Even if you're "DIY challenged," this one's foolproof.
Lightweight Enough to Carry One-Handed Weighing in at just 2.5kg (that's lighter than a bag of apples!), this table is a game-changer for anyone who moves frequently. No more asking neighbors for help or renting a truck for a single piece of furniture. Tuck it under your arm, head to your new place, and rebuild in minutes., rejoice—this is the furniture you've been waiting for.
Eco-Friendly from Start to Finish Every part of this table is designed to leave a lighter footprint. The paper tubes come from recycled cardboard (hello, second life!), and when you're done with it? It goes right back into the recycling bin, no guilt attached. Compare that to traditional furniture, which often ends up in landfills or requires harsh chemicals to break down. This is "from a tree to a table" reimagined as "from a recycled paper to a table to a recycled paper again"—a true.
Surprisingly Strong (We Tested It) We get it—you're skeptical. "Paper can't hold my stuff!" But here's the secret: the honeycomb structure of the paper tubes, reinforced by the modular connectors, creates a load-bearing design that can handle up to 20kg. That's enough for a stack of books, a lamp, and your laptop—all at once. We even had a colleague stand on it (don't try that at home, but we wanted to be sure) and it held steady. High-strength paper tube furniture isn't just a marketing term; it's engineering magic.
Water-Resistant (With a Little Help) Spills happen. That's why the table's surface is treated with a nano-coating that repels water (think: coffee splashes bead right off), and the plastic foot covers lift it off the floor, keeping it safe from accidental mopping mishaps or damp basements. Just keep your space's humidity below 60% (a quick check with a $10 hygrometer does the trick), and this table will stay dry and happy for years.

Assembling It: So Easy, a Toddler Could Do It (Almost)

Let's walk through the assembly process, because we promise it's not just "easy"—it's actually kind of fun. Here's how it goes:

  1. Unpack the Box: Inside, you'll find pre-cut paper tubes, color-coded 3-way/4-way connectors, a drawer (already assembled!), and plastic foot covers. Everything is labeled with simple icons, so you won't mix up parts.
  2. Build the Frame: Take the longest paper tubes and connect them with the 4-way connectors to form the main frame. It's like building with giant Tinkertoys—no force needed; the connectors click into place with a satisfying "snap."
  3. Add the Shelves: Slide the shorter tubes into the 3-way connectors to create the open shelf and drawer frame. The drawer fits right into its slot—no rails, no fuss.
  4. Attach the Feet: Pop the plastic foot covers onto the bottom tubes. They're soft enough to protect your floors but sturdy enough to keep the table level.
  5. Done! Stand back and admire your handiwork. Total time? 8 minutes (we timed three people—slowest was 11 minutes, and they were taking selfies while assembling).

Pro tip: If you're customizing the color (they offer everything from classic white to forest green to millennial pink), the tubes come pre-painted, so no messy spray cans or paint drips. Just assemble and enjoy.
